VDH seeks volunteers

The West Piedmont Health District of the Virginia Department of Health is looking for medical and nonmedical residents to serve on its Medical Reserve Corps. The MRC is a specialized component of the Citizen Corps, a national network of volunteers dedicated to ensuring hometown security.

Volunteers can assist in public health emergencies such as the H1N1 pandemic and nonemergency public health services such as education and community outreach.
